Summary and conclusions This study investigated the impact of stack pressure fixture designs on testing lithium-ion pouch cells. In particular, how well different fixtures concepts apply stack pressure consistently over time. The pressure loss was evaluated from an initial stack pressure of 90 kPa for a cell resting for 48 h.
Pressure mapping applications for EV Batteries. Flexible Tekscan Model 7800 matrix sensor wraps around battery components. The Model 7800 is designed specifically for battery testing. This flexible, thin sensor wraps around the cell and between layers to provide a 360◦ view of battery pressure.
